Well-known SIDs

This page is the catalog. The conceptual material — what each principal means, when to use which SID, how the principals interact with the access check — is in Well-known principals. Use this page when you need a specific SID value.

The catalog is organised by identifier authority — the second number in the SID string.

Universal SIDs (authorities 0, 1, 2, 3)

These authorities are globally-defined; their SIDs mean the same thing on every Peios system.

SID Name Notes
S-1-0-0 Nobody Matches nothing. Used as a deliberate placeholder.
S-1-1-0 Everyone Matches every token, including Anonymous.
S-1-2-0 Local Matches tokens from local logons.
S-1-2-1 Console Logon Matches tokens from physical/console sessions.
S-1-3-0 Creator Owner Placeholder. Substituted with the new object's owner at inheritance.
S-1-3-1 Creator Group Placeholder. Substituted with the new object's primary group.
S-1-3-4 Owner Rights Special. Suppresses owner implicit rights when present in a DACL.

NT Authority SIDs (authority 5)

The largest set of well-known SIDs.

Logon classifiers and system actors

SID Name Notes
S-1-5-2 Network Token came from a network logon.
S-1-5-4 Interactive Token came from an interactive logon.
S-1-5-6 Service Token came from a service start.
S-1-5-7 Anonymous Anonymous-level identity.
S-1-5-10 Principal Self Placeholder; substituted with the caller-supplied self_sid at access check.
S-1-5-11 Authenticated Users Every authenticated token. Excludes Anonymous.
S-1-5-18 Local System (SYSTEM) The kernel and TCB.
S-1-5-19 Local Service Built-in service account, reduced privileges.
S-1-5-20 Network Service Built-in service account, network-authenticating.

Logon SID pattern

Pattern Meaning
S-1-5-5-X-Y The session-specific SID for one authentication event. X and Y are derived from the session's LUID (high and low 32 bits). Every token of the session carries this SID with SE_GROUP_LOGON_ID set.

S-1-5-5-0-0 specifically is the bootstrap SYSTEM session's logon SID. Other sessions get derived values.

BUILTIN aliases (sub-authority 32)

SID Name
S-1-5-32-544 BUILTIN\Administrators
S-1-5-32-545 BUILTIN\Users
S-1-5-32-546 BUILTIN\Guests
S-1-5-32-547 BUILTIN\Power Users
S-1-5-32-551 BUILTIN\Backup Operators
S-1-5-32-555 BUILTIN\Remote Desktop Users
S-1-5-32-559 BUILTIN\Performance Log Users
S-1-5-32-560 BUILTIN\Performance Monitor Users
S-1-5-32-562 BUILTIN\Distributed COM Users
S-1-5-32-568 BUILTIN\IIS_IUSRS
S-1-5-32-569 BUILTIN\Cryptographic Operators
S-1-5-32-573 BUILTIN\Event Log Readers
S-1-5-32-574 BUILTIN\Certificate Service DCOM Access
S-1-5-32-575 BUILTIN\RDS Remote Access Servers
S-1-5-32-578 BUILTIN\Hyper-V Administrators
S-1-5-32-579 BUILTIN\Access Control Assistance Operators
S-1-5-32-580 BUILTIN\Remote Management Users
S-1-5-32-583 BUILTIN\Device Owners

The full BUILTIN catalog uses values 544 through 583 (with gaps). v0.20 recognises all of them by convention; specific entries beyond Administrators, Users, Guests, and Backup Operators are typically not used in default deployments.

Domain SIDs

Pattern Meaning
S-1-5-21-DA1-DA2-DA3-RID A principal in a specific domain. DA1-DA2-DA3 identifies the domain; RID identifies the principal.

Reserved RIDs within S-1-5-21-*:

RID Meaning
500 Domain Administrator
501 Domain Guest
502 krbtgt (Kerberos ticket-granting account)
512 Domain Admins
513 Domain Users
514 Domain Guests
515 Domain Computers
516 Domain Controllers
517 Cert Publishers
518 Schema Admins
519 Enterprise Admins
520 Group Policy Creator Owners
521 Read-only Domain Controllers
522 Cloneable Domain Controllers
525 Protected Users
526 Key Admins
527 Enterprise Key Admins

Principals beyond these reserved RIDs get RIDs ≥ 1000.

Service SIDs

Pattern Meaning
S-1-5-80-h1-h2-h3-h4-h5 Service SID derived from service name. The 5 hash values come from SHA-1 of UTF-16LE-uppercased service name, split into 5 little-endian 32-bit integers.

Mandatory integrity labels (authority 16)

These are labels, not principals. The integer RID encodes the integrity level.

SID Level RID Name
S-1-16-0 0 Untrusted
S-1-16-4096 4096 Low
S-1-16-8192 8192 Medium
S-1-16-12288 12288 High
S-1-16-16384 16384 System

The values are spaced by 4096 to leave room for additional levels.

Process integrity protection labels (authority 19)

PIP labels are also not principals; they encode the (type, trust) pair.

Pattern Meaning
S-1-19-T-L PIP label. T = PIP type (0, 512, or 1024). L = trust level within the type.

Specific values used in v0.20:

SID Type Trust Name
S-1-19-0-0 None (0) 0 No PIP protection
S-1-19-512-1024 Protected (512) 1024 Authenticode-signed third-party
S-1-19-512-1536 Protected 1536 AntiMalware
S-1-19-512-2048 Protected 2048 Peios-distributed app
S-1-19-512-4096 Protected 4096 Core Peios component
S-1-19-512-8192 Protected 8192 Peios TCB
S-1-19-1024-8192 Isolated (1024) 8192 Reserved — no v0.20 signing key targets Isolated

Confinement SIDs (authority 15, sub-authority 2)

SID Name
S-1-15-2-1 ALL_APPLICATION_PACKAGES
S-1-15-2-2 ALL_RESTRICTED_APPLICATION_PACKAGES

Plus per-application confinement SIDs:

Pattern Meaning
S-1-15-2-h1-h2-h3-h4-h5-h6-h7-h8 Application-specific confinement SID derived from the application's package identifier. SHA-256 split into 8 little-endian 32-bit integers.

Capability SIDs (authority 15, sub-authority 3)

Well-known capabilities

SID Capability
S-1-15-3-1 internetClient
S-1-15-3-2 internetClientServer
S-1-15-3-3 privateNetworkClientServer
S-1-15-3-4 (reserved)
S-1-15-3-5 (reserved)
S-1-15-3-6 (reserved)
S-1-15-3-7 (reserved)
S-1-15-3-8 enterpriseAuthentication
S-1-15-3-9 sharedUserCertificates
S-1-15-3-10 removableStorage

Derived capabilities

Pattern Meaning
S-1-15-3-h1-h2-h3-h4-h5-h6-h7-h8 Capability SID derived from capability name. SHA-256 split into 8 little-endian 32-bit integers. Same name → same SID.

SID-and-attributes flags

When a SID appears in a group list (or in restricted SIDs, confinement capabilities, etc.), it carries a 32-bit attributes value. The defined flags:

Flag Value Meaning
SE_GROUP_MANDATORY 0x00000001 Group cannot be disabled.
SE_GROUP_ENABLED_BY_DEFAULT 0x00000002 Enabled at token creation.
SE_GROUP_ENABLED 0x00000004 Currently enabled.
SE_GROUP_OWNER 0x00000008 Can be selected as object owner.
SE_GROUP_USE_FOR_DENY_ONLY 0x00000010 Matches only deny ACEs; permanent.
SE_GROUP_INTEGRITY 0x00000020 Identifies an integrity SID (ABI parity; MIC uses integrity_level field, not this flag).
SE_GROUP_INTEGRITY_ENABLED 0x00000040 Used with SE_GROUP_INTEGRITY.
SE_GROUP_RESOURCE 0x20000000 Domain-local group from resource domain (metadata only in v0.20).
SE_GROUP_LOGON_ID 0xC0000000 The per-session logon SID. Cannot be disabled.

SID format constants

For reference:

Constant Value Meaning
SID revision 0x01 Set in byte 0 of every binary SID.
Max SubAuthority count 15 Maximum value of byte 1.
SID min size 8 bytes Revision + count + authority, no sub-authorities.
SID max size 68 bytes Revision + count + authority + 15 × 4-byte sub-authorities.
